Painter of portraits and historical subjects.

Swerts was a student of Nicaise De Keyser and became a director of the Academy of Prague. He produced decorative paintings in collaboration with Guffens in the churches of Notre-Dame, Saint Nicolas (Waas) and Saint George in Antwerp, in the market hall of Ypres and in the city hall of Courtrai.

When he died, he had just completed the decoration of the Chapel of the Notre-Dame consecrated to the Virgin and St. Anne in the St. Vit Cathedral in Prague.
